Output 886fd63b8b35047040bf68c65bba9f097e32cc8c83be184c36c43e9a925fb0b6:8

value
333925
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a25a5ef509472646d73772c7d8e1dcd7ec1a9ec OP_EQUAL
address
32cfnJZnL1wBTSqC8wVWVhoZ36xa6WHEV3
transaction
886fd63b8b35047040bf68c65bba9f097e32cc8c83be184c36c43e9a925fb0b6
confirmations
273
spent
true